Is GVWR the same as empty weight?
Gross Vehicle Weight ( GVWR ) is the weight of the vehicle at full capacity. It includes the curb weight, or empty weight, plus the weight of the driver, all passengers, engine, engine fluids, fuel, and the cargo that the vehicle is carrying.

How much does a garbage truck weigh?
Long-haul trucks and their contents can weigh 80,000 pounds. However, the shorter wheelbase of garbage and recycling trucks results in a much lower legal weight — usually around 51,000 pounds. Since these trucks weigh about 33,000 pounds empty, they have a legal payload of about nine tons.
How many tons does a tractor trailer weigh?
A semi-tractor without a trailer can weigh up to 25,000 pounds. A semi-truck with an empty trailer weighs around 35,000 pounds. An 18-wheeler with a loaded trailer can weigh as much as 40 tons, or 80,000 pounds.

How much does a 18 wheeler cost?
What does an eighteen wheeler cost? While there are myriad variables on the costs, the CAB of an eighteen wheeler usually ranges from $130,000 to $180,000 new. New trailers usually range from $30,000 to $80,00. So all in all you could be paying over a quarter-million dollars for a new truck and trailer.

Is owning a 18 wheeler profitable?
An owner operator may take home around $2000-$5000+ weekly, while an investor can make a profit of $500-$2000+ per truck weekly. However, there are many factors that affect profitability. Truck repairs and maintenance. Type of operations (dry van, reefer, flatbed, team)
How much do independent truckers make?
According to Indeed, an independent truck driver’s gross pay averages $183,000 per year, but expenses can run over 70% percent. Thus the average owner operator pay drops to around $50,000-$60,000 take-home. Many independent truck drivers sign with a carrier to get consistent work.
How much do self employed truck drivers make?
Considering other factors such as age, education, sex, and family status, self-employed truck drivers earn about five percent more per hour compared to company drivers, bringing their average salary up to about $45,500 annually.

Why do truck drivers make so much money?
Truck Drivers are typically paid a set rate per mile that they travel, not for how long they work. You may find some companies paying more because of the high demand for Class A licensed Truck Drivers due to the ongoing truck driver shortage. …
